KEY INVESTMENT THEMES FOR FORWARD-THINKING INVESTORS
“People should be excited about this area because if you look back 30 years ago, the internet barely existed. Now we have multi-trillion dollar companies,” Reza emphasized. “What people fail to realize is that today there are companies that no one’s heard of that will be multi-trillion dollar companies in the future.”

Reza highlighted several compelling investment themes:

• AI EVOLUTION: The market is shifting from infrastructure players like NVIDIA to companies developing practical AI applications across industries.
• BIOTECH BREAKTHROUGHS: Opportunities in specialized areas like liquid biopsies for early cancer detection.
• SPACE ECONOMY: Dramatically reduced launch costs (from $80,000 per kilogram in the 1980s to potentially hundreds of dollars) opening new commercial opportunities.

GEOGRAPHIC DIVERSIFICATION IN A DECOUPLING WORLD
For high-net-worth families concerned about concentration risk, Reza’s approach to geographic diversification offers particular value.

“The world is decoupling somewhat,” Reza noted. “As China rises, some key industries like EVs, semis, and AI may decouple from the West and that creates additional opportunities and risks.” This creates both challenges and opportunities, with the KJH Technology & Growth Fund strategically positioned across:

• Chinese internet companies (with measured exposure)
• Latin American e-commerce leaders like MercadoLibre
• Indian technology firms benefiting from manufacturing shift s and soft ware outsourcing strengths

THE LONG VIEW: WHY DISCIPLINE MATTERS—AND OPPORTUNITY SHOULDN’T BE IGNORED
For families considering significant allocations to technology and growth, Reza offered this perspective:
“From the peak, the market is down about 20%. That doesn’t happen that often…You’re getting a 20% discount on the market, right? And that’s a rare event.”

While Reza strongly supports disciplined strategies like dollar-cost averaging and maintaining consistent exposure to growth sectors within a diversified portfolio, he also encourages long-term investors to stay alert to rare opportunities. When markets experience meaningful pullbacks, selectively deploying spare capital can be a smart complement to a steady investment approach—not a contradiction to it.
